Cup Final ticket sales
I believe there were two points selling. You can also buy online. We are a small club with limited resources and staff so folk will really just have to be patient. Lots of time left to buy as well. That is a pretty poor excuse. Two selling points to sell thousands of tickets. If I was a casual fan thinking of going would I bother to wait two hours in a queue when I most likely have other things on. The only thing it could possibly lead to is reduced sales. Compare this to the final when County got there. If I remember right they had about 10+ selling points to meet demand. They also ordered in thousands of extra strips to sell for the final, selling them in Tesco as well with other stands in the town. Also busses were sourced from all over Scotland and even England to meet demand. I just have this feeling our club won't be as organised, with two selling points on the first day a good example. Will we run out of tops in the next week as well? If we had a multimillionaire bankrolling things we could probably do it too. Things to remember- 1. Sale is only to priority groups. 2. It's a bank holiday and people are off. 3. It's the first day of sales. 4. They can be bought online. 5. There's no chance we won't meet demand (unfortunately) 5. There's physically only 2 tills that sell tickets. Personally I'd rather we didn't waste money on IT, software etc that would be needed to open a couple more tills that will probably be only needed for a few days. Trust me buses could be sourced from all over the country that's not the issue. It's the price as they'll be over twice the normal cost if memory serves.
